Nicky is a passionate, intersectional African feminist, who has focused on advancing gender justice and eradicating violence against women and girls and gender diverse folk, for more than 25 years.
Nicky’s worldview is firmly grounded in an anti-racist and decolonial perspective, which provides the ideological framework for her work. Her engagement extends across the African continent, where she delves into the complex interplay of women’s identities and the myriad forms of violence they confront. Through her extensive experience, she has gained a deep understanding of both the profound vulnerability and remarkable resilience exhibited by women throughout the continent. She is also a very active supporter of the incorporation of healing within grantmaking and addressing trauma within the civil society space.  At the core of Nicky’s mission is the creation of inclusive and empowering spaces for women and gender diverse communities. These spaces serve as catalysts for cross-cultural learning solidarity, and the cultivation of social movements. Nicky currently serves as the Senior Program Officer of the Gender, Racial, and Ethnic Justice portfolio at the Ford Foundation’s Office of Southern Africa. In this role, she continues to be a driving force in the pursuit of a more just and equitable world.
